I have a L 1300 on which I use Windows XP home. For some month this computer shows a vast amount of more or less bizzare problems:

1) First the computer started itself after standing in "rest mode" fore some 15 or 30 minutes. That continued for some weeks. Then other problems came:
2) The computer closes itself after one or two yours use.
3) When using Internet Explorer, the program suddenly goes to full screen mode and removes all toolbars in the top. At the same time the lowest scroll bar begins to slowly move to the right.
4) When using any kind of program I suddenly find that I cannot use the keyboard at all. Nothing happens. Or: I can write a few letters or digits, but very slowly.
5) When using the Explorer it shows the same symptoms as Internet explorer: The menues disappears.
6) The desktop: When a click on any object, trying to activate it, the right click meny shows up. It can then be used.

Some kind of virus maybe? No! I did a clean install of the OS, and the symptoms were the same!

I then tried to clean the fan, because it had a big noise. It became a little better: The fan sound went down about 25% and the computer can now be used for about an hour before it breaks down again. (Before the cleaning it could be used just a few minutes before it broke down." But all the problem described above is still there! It just takes longer time before they show up.

Maybe a memory problem? No! I bought a 512 MB memory and replaced one of the original 256 MG memories. No difference occured!

A friend suggested that maybe a key in the internal keyboard is partly stuck and causes the problem. OK, but what to then?!
